Number … WebJan 15, 2024 · The key to solving projectile motion problems is to treat the x motion and the y motion separately. But we are given an initial velocity vo which is a mix of the two of them. We have no choice but to break up the initial velocity into its x and y components. Now we’re ready to get started.
